ABOUT THE TEAM
The Core Platform and AI Engineering team at Parametric is responsible for enhancing the quality and velocity of engineering outcomes across the technology organization through platform-level capabilities, accelerating engineering teams and enabling them to focus on delivering business value.
This team delivers Parametric's platform-level service and development capabilities. These efforts seek to optimize the organization's technology posture by providing common solutions to shared problems, driving standardization, accelerated delivery, reduced risk and cost, and scalable, high-performing results. The team serves engineering teams across the organization and is responsible for supporting their success.
ABOUT THE ROLE
The Principal Software Engineer, AI Platform, will serve as the AI engineering team lead, acting as a core technical enabler across business units. This individual will apply deep knowledge of ML, NLP, transformer architectures, and LLMs to build Parametric's GenAI platform and design, evaluate, and operationalize generative AI solutions running on this platform.
This role bridges business stakeholders and engineering teams, translating business problems into technical solutions grounded in data availability and feasibility while enabling engineering teams to fully utilize the advanced AI capabilities available at Morgan Stanley. Through expertise in the AI development lifecycle, from problem framing through evaluation and regression testing, combined with a platform mindset, this role ensures Parametric's GenAI solutions are robust, measurable, and continuously improving.
This role will lead the engineering effort for Parametric's GenAI platform, supporting a wide range of production workloads in collaboration with internal engineering teams. The platform serves as the foundation for AI capabilities, operations, and governance within Parametric, enabling engineering teams to rapidly create safe, compliant, and highly effective GenAI-based solutions which directly solve business needs.
Parametric values strong software engineering and takes pride in its culture of technical rigor, modern practices, and continuous growth. This role will help translate that culture into practical platform solutions which promote engineering effectiveness and consistent delivery.
PRIMARY RESPONSIBILITIES
- Provide technical leadership by directly managing a team of engineers, guiding and mentoring them to achieve their highest potential while collectively advancing the goals and projects of the engineering team.
- Drive vision and strategy for the team while exemplifying strong leadership skills, including communication, consensus building, elevated standards, ownership, accountability, and project management.
- Lead GenAI development projects, including all components of the development lifecycle, from requirements gathering to deployment, bug fixes, enhancements, and escalated support.
- Work directly with business users and engineering teams to build strong relationships, understand requirements, scope solutions, and communicate technical trade-offs in accessible terms.
- Design, develop, and maintain high-quality and flexible platform-level technical solutions to GenAI engineering problems, including reusable components, governance processes, model evaluation, services, and APIs.
- Design, develop, and maintain platform-level GenAI applications leveraging prompt engineering, RAG pipelines, fine-tuning, and agentic workflows to drive business outcomes.
- Translate business problems into technical solutions by assessing data availability, feasibility, and alignment with GenAI capabilities.
- Support the AI development lifecycle end-to-end: problem scoping, data assessment, solution design, implementation, evaluation, deployment, and iteration.
- Design and execute AI system evaluation frameworks, including quantitative metrics definition, discriminative testing (e.g., A/B, sensitivity analysis), regression testing, and continuous quality monitoring of GenAI outputs.
- Apply deep knowledge of ML, NLP, transformer architectures, and LLM internals (tokenization, attention, decoding strategies, fine-tuning paradigms) to select, adapt, and optimize foundation models (OpenAI, Llama, open source, etc.) for diverse use cases.
- Conduct code and design reviews for developers working on generative AI solutions, ensuring adherence to our engineering best practices and evaluation standards.
- Implement and manage cloud deployments using AWS services, ensuring high availability, scalability, and observability.
- Maintain and enhance existing AI applications to improve model performance, reliability, and user experience through data-driven iteration.
- Follow GenAI and related technology trends and recommend improvements to our systems when appropriate.
